What made Omegle popular in the first place
Omegle's core idea was deceptively simple: click once, get a stranger. No profile, no algorithm, no social graph. The randomness was the point. You didn't know if the next match would be a philosophy student in Berlin or a retiree in Osaka — and that uncertainty is what kept people coming back.
The platform had serious problems — moderation was inadequate, especially for younger users — but the underlying concept of effortless random connection was never the issue. That idea is now the foundation for a generation of better-designed alternatives.
What to look for in an Omegle alternative
Not all random video chat platforms are equal. When evaluating an Omegle alternative, look for:
- Real-time moderation — AI or human review that actually reduces harmful content before it reaches you
- Anonymous entry — no forced account creation before your first session
- Report and block tools — accessible within the call, not buried in settings
- Mobile support — a modern platform should work without downloading an app
- Something beyond pure randomness — swipe discovery, interest matching, or live games make conversations better

2. Chatroulette — The OG random roulette
Chatroulette launched even before Omegle and is still running. It has improved substantially in the last few years — a "Smart Filter" blocks explicit content automatically. The interface is minimal: one button, one stranger. Best for users who want the purest random-match experience with no extras.
3. Chatspin — Interest matching and country filters
Chatspin adds light interest-based matching on top of the random formula. You can filter by country and apply fun face filters. More polished than older platforms; the free tier is limited but enough to evaluate whether it suits you.
4. Emerald Chat — Community and anti-bot focus
Emerald Chat positioned itself explicitly as "the clean Omegle alternative" — stricter moderation, karma-style reputation scores, and interest tags for better match quality. Smaller user base than VibeMeet or Chatroulette, but community quality is generally higher.
5. Camsurf — Moderated and family-friendly
Camsurf targets a broader demographic and is heavily moderated. Useful if you want random video chat without any adult content risk. Less feature-rich than the others, but consistently available and reliable.

What happened to Omegle?
Omegle shut down in November 2023 after 14 years of operation. The founder cited the mounting costs of moderating the platform and legal pressures as the primary reasons. Millions of daily users were left looking for alternatives.
